Fincar: A Medication for Treating Male Pattern Hair Loss

Fincar is a medication that is commonly used to treat male pattern hair loss. It belongs to a class of drugs called 5-alpha-reductase inhibitors, which work by reducing the production of a hormone called dihydrotestosterone (DHT) in the body. DHT is known to contribute to hair loss in men.

Here are some key points to know about Fincar:

  • Fincar is the brand name for the generic drug finasteride.
  • It is available in tablet form and is taken orally.
  • It is approved by the FDA for the treatment of male pattern hair loss.
  • Fincar is not intended for use by women or children.
  • It is important to note that Fincar is a prescription medication and should only be taken under the supervision of a healthcare professional.

Research has shown that Fincar can be effective in slowing down hair loss and promoting hair regrowth in men with male pattern baldness. It is believed to work by inhibiting the enzyme that converts testosterone into DHT, which is responsible for shrinking hair follicles.

According to a study published in the Journal of the American Academy of Dermatology, Fincar was found to be effective in promoting hair growth in men with male pattern hair loss. In the study, participants who took Fincar experienced an increase in hair count and thickness compared to those who took a placebo.

It is important to note that Fincar may take several months to show visible results, and the medication needs to be taken consistently for the effects to be maintained. Additionally, hair regrowth may not occur in all individuals, and the results may vary.

As with any medication, Fincar may cause side effects in some individuals. The most common side effects reported include decreased libido, erectile dysfunction, and decreased ejaculate volume. However, these side effects are often temporary and resolve once the medication is discontinued.

How Men’s Health ED Meds Work

Men’s health ED meds work by increasing blood flow to the penis, which helps to relax the muscles and improve the ability to achieve an erection. They belong to a class of medications called ph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5) inhibitors. These drugs work by inhibiting the enzyme PDE5, which is responsible for breaking down the chemical cyclic guanosine monophosphate (cGMP) in the body. By inhibiting PDE5, the amount of cGMP increases, leading to the relaxation of blood vessels and increased blood flow to the penis, ultimately resulting in an erection.

4. Discuss the effectiveness and side effects of Fincar:

Fincar has been clinically proven to be effective in treating male pattern hair loss. It works by inhibiting the conversion of test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(DHT), which is the hormone responsible for shrinking hair follicles and causing hair loss. By reducing DHT levels, Fincar helps to promote hair growth and prevent further hair loss.

Studies have shown that Fincar can significantly increase hair density and hair count, leading to a noticeable improvement in hair loss symptoms. In one study, participants who took Fincar daily for 12 months experienced a 14.6% increase in hair count compared to a placebo group.

See also  Ensuring Safe and Legal Access to Men's Health Medications - Considerations, Risks, and Affordable Options

While Fincar can be effective in treating male pattern hair loss, it is important to note that it may not work for everyone. Results can vary depending on the individual and the severity of the hair loss. It is also important to note that Fincar needs to be taken continuously for the effects to be maintained. If treatment with Fincar is discontinued, any hair growth achieved may be lost within 12 months.

Like any medication, Fincar can have potential side effects. Some common side effects include decreased libido, erectile dysfunction, and ejaculation disorders. These side effects are generally mild and reversible, and they generally improve over time with continued use of the medication. However, if any of these side effects persist or worsen, it is important to consult a healthcare professional.

It is also important to note that Fincar should not be handled by women or children, as it can be absorbed through the skin and may cause birth defects or other harmful effects.

7. Side effects and precautions:

Fincar, like any medication, can cause side effects in some individuals. Common side effects of Fincar include impotence, decreased libido, testicular pain, and breast enlargement. These side effects are generally reversible and will subside once the medication is stopped.

It is important to note that not all individuals will experience these side effects, and some individuals may experience different side effects not listed here. If you experience any unusual or severe side effects while taking Fincar, it is important to contact your healthcare provider.

In addition to the potential side effects, there are also some precautions to consider before taking Fincar:

  • Pregnant women or women who may become pregnant should not handle crushed or broken tablets of Fincar.
  • Fincar should not be taken by women or children.
  • Individuals with liver disease, prostate cancer, or urinary problems should consult their healthcare provider before taking Fincar.
  • Fincar may interact with other medications, so it is important to inform your healthcare provider of any other medications you are taking.
  • Regular prostate exams should be conducted while taking Fincar to monitor for any potential prostate issues.
